COSWRT

Print out details of the COSMO surface to a file called <file>.cos.  Quantities printed include the solvent accessible surface area, per atom, and the segment that make up the SAS.

The points on the SAS are printed; these can then be used with a graphics package to give a pictorial representation of the SAS.
